23 package com.sun.c1x.ir; | |
24 | |
25 import com.sun.c1x.debug.*; | |
26 import com.sun.cri.ci.*; | |
27 | |
28 /** | |
29 * The {@code Base} instruction represents the end of the entry block of the procedure that has | |
30 * both the standard entry and the OSR entry as successors. | |
31 * | |
32 * @author Ben L. Titzer | |
33 */ | |
34 public final class Base extends BlockEnd { | |
35 | |
36 /** | |
37 * Constructs a new Base instruction. | |
38 * @param standardEntry the standard entrypoint block | |
39 * @param osrEntry the OSR entrypoint block | |
40 */ | |
41 public Base(BlockBegin standardEntry, BlockBegin osrEntry) { | |
42 super(CiKind.Illegal, null, false); | |
43 assert osrEntry == null || osrEntry.isOsrEntry(); | |
44 assert standardEntry.isStandardEntry(); | |
45 if (osrEntry != null) { | |
46 successors.add(osrEntry); | |
47 } | |
48 successors.add(standardEntry); | |
49 } | |
50 | |
51 /** | |
52 * Gets the standard entrypoint block. | |
53 * @return the standard entrypoint block | |
54 */ | |
55 public BlockBegin standardEntry() { | |
56 return defaultSuccessor(); | |
57 } | |
58 | |
59 /** | |
60 * Gets the OSR entrypoint block, if it exists. | |
61 * @return the OSR entrypoint bock, if it exists; {@code null} otherwise | |
62 */ | |
63 public BlockBegin osrEntry() { | |
64 return successors.size() < 2 ? null : successors.get(0); | |
65 } | |
66 | |
67 @Override | |
68 public void accept(ValueVisitor v) { | |
69 v.visitBase(this); | |
70 } | |
71 | |
72 @Override | |
73 public void print(LogStream out) { | |
74 out.print("std entry B").print(standardEntry().blockID); | |
75 if (successors().size() > 1) { | |
76 out.print(" osr entry B").print(osrEntry().blockID); | |
77 } | |
78 } | |
79 } |
